El Blog del Narco is a blog that emerged in the early 2010s, with the primary goal of sharing information and videos related to Mexican organized crime, specifically the activities of cartels such as Los Zetas, Sinaloa, and Gulf cartels. The blog's creator, whose identity remains unknown, aimed to shed light on the brutal reality of the narco world, where violence, corruption, and intimidation are everyday tools. Over time, El Blog del Narco has become a go-to source for those seeking to understand the inner workings of these criminal organizations. The Current State of the Platform El Blog
